How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Royal Lakes?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Royal Lakes Studio Apartments | $1,131 | $900 | $1,340 |
Royal Lakes 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,339 | $800 | $2,647 |
Royal Lakes 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,570 | $1,020 | $2,912 |
Royal Lakes 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,045 | $1,345 | $3,563 |
Royal Lakes 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,952 | $1,900 | $2,004 |
